Introduce students to electronics and maker skills with a hands-on Smart Soldering Kit that bridges creativity and coding.
- Solder working LEDs and onto a printed circuit board
- Battery-powered for immediate feedback
- Ready to plug-and-play with other micro:bit coding projects
The Smart Soldering Kit is the perfect way to introduce new learners to the skill of soldering! Plus, once finished, the Traffic Light component is compatible with the rest of the micro:bit powered coding & robotics products from Forward Education, like the Climate Action Kit. This means that learners can both build and solder their own functioning robotic component, as well as actually program the component using a micro:bit and MakeCode!
The Smart Soldering Kit comes with all of the components that are to be soldered onto the board which consists of buttons, resistors, lights, and a battery holder. Materials and tools to actually solder the board are not included.
A Forward Education Breakout Board, cable connector, and V2 micro:bit (available separately) are required to actually complete any coding projects with the component.

What tools are required for the Smart Soldering Kit?
To use the Smart Soldering Kit you will need to have a soldering gun and led-free solder. These are not included with the kit. You may also want to use safety googles and a silicone mat for extra protection.
How do I code the Smart Soldering Kit component?
To code the Smart Soldering Kit component, you will need to have a Breakout Board from Forward Education, a cable connector, and a V2 micro:bit. You can find all of these components in the Climate Action Kit.
